How are shapley values calculated

WebHoje · When combined with medical data, Shapley values enhance the utility of ML methods for hypothesis generation in addition to hypothesis testing [6]. There is also some evidence to suggest that such explanations inspire some degree of understanding, awareness, and trust, particularly for those with domain knowledge in the given task [86] … Web14 de set. de 2024 · We learn the SHAP values, and how the SHAP values help to explain the predictions of your machine learning model. It is helpful to remember the following points: Each feature has a shap value ...

Shapley Values - A Gentle Introduction H2O.ai

Web26 de out. de 2024 · Image by Author. Mathematical formulation of the Shapley value. where S is a coalition, or subset, of players. In plain English, the Shapley value is … WebShapley values. In 2024 Scott M. Lundberg and Su-In Lee published the article “A Unified Approach to Interpreting Model Predictions” where they proposed SHAP (SHapley Additive exPlanations), a model-agnostic approach based on Lloyd Shapley ideas for interpreting predictions. Lloyd Shapley (Nobel Prize in Economy 2012) proposed the notion of the so … phone commercial singer https://caden-net.com

A new perspective on Shapley values, part II: The Naïve Shapley …

WebThe Shap calculation based on three data features only to make this example as simple as possible. Also, you will be introduced to a main Shapley value formula, where we will … WebKey Takeaways. Shapley value is the derivation of the applied cost and gained profit—distributed equally among the players—based on individual contribution. In machine learning, Shapley values employ game theory to identify the exact contribution of each player. In addition, the Shapley method explains projections made by nonlinear models. Web12 de abr. de 2024 · Deep learning algorithms (DLAs) are becoming hot tools in processing geochemical survey data for mineral exploration. However, it is difficult to understand their working mechanisms and decision-making behaviors, which may lead to unreliable results. The construction of a reliable and interpretable DLA has become a focus in data-driven … how do you make an itinerary

Shapley Value - Definition, Explained, Example, Interpretation

Category:Shapley value analysis Ads Data Hub Google Developers

Tags:How are shapley values calculated

How are shapley values calculated

What is Shapley value regression and how does one implement it?

Web7 de mai. de 2024 · Shapley value (let us denote it SV) uses a finite formula of combinatorial kind to assign a unique distribution among all the players who yield a total surplus in their coalition. In a brief lay explanation, the SV allocates the total value of the game to each player by evaluating over all possible coalitions that a player can join in. Web6 de ago. de 2024 · The Shapley Value is a way of allocating credit for the total outcome achieved among these many cooperating factors. A simple analogy for building our intuition is that of a soccer game. If the striker scores the most goals, he or she will traditionally get all of the credit (this is effectively Last Interaction attribution as the striker got the last …

How are shapley values calculated

Did you know?

WebThis may lead to unwanted consequences. In the following tutorial, Natalie Beyer will show you how to use the SHAP (SHapley Additive exPlanations) package in Python to get closer to explainable machine learning results. In this tutorial, you will learn how to use the SHAP package in Python applied to a practical example step by step. Web10 de abr. de 2024 · We calculated variable importance scores using the “model_parts” function from the “DALEX” package (version 2.4.3; Biecek, 2024). ... Shapley values are designed to attribute the difference between a model's prediction and an average baseline to the different predictor variables used as inputs to the model.

Web19 de jul. de 2024 · Note, that the shap package actually uses a different method to estimate the shapley values. import shap # explain the model's predictions using SHAP explainer … WebShapley value regression is a method for evaluating the importance of features in a regression model by calculating the Shapley values of those features. ... For example, for a given prediction, the contribution of each feature is calculated by subtracting the projected value with and without the feature.

Web11 de jan. de 2024 · Shapley value = the average of all the values calculated in step 5 (i.e., the average of F’s marginal contributions) In short, the Shapley value of a feature F is the … Web1. So I'm trying to estimate a Shapley value in a game with uncertain payoffs. Specifically, imagine a game where the payoff function as as follows. (A) = 1 (B) = 2 (B,C) = 4. For …

WebShapley value, has a nice interpretation in terms of expected marginal contribution. It is calculated by considering all the possible orders of arrival of the players into a room and giving each player his marginal contribution. The following examples illustrate this.

Web26 de mar. de 2024 · Shapley Additive exPlanations A Python package called Shapley Additive exPlanations (SHAP) is a popular implementation used to calculate approximate Shapley values for models. The example in Figure 1 has only three variables and can be calculated exhaustively, but for a model of n variables we require 2n possible model … how do you make an offer on a houseWeb2 de mai. de 2024 · Introduction. Major tasks for machine learning (ML) in chemoinformatics and medicinal chemistry include predicting new bioactive small molecules or the potency of active compounds [1–4].Typically, such predictions are carried out on the basis of molecular structure, more specifically, using computational descriptors calculated from molecular … phone comcast serviceWebI'm trying to understand how the base value is calculated. So I used an example from SHAP's github notebook, Census income classification with LightGBM. Right after I … how do you make an offerWeb22 de mar. de 2024 · Shapley value is an average marginal contribution of a player over all the possible different permutations (scenarios) in which coalition can be constructed. In case of two players, coalition can be formed as: Scenario 2: Firm Firm II first, Firm I second. Scenario 1: marginal value added of firm 1 is 3 units, since it enters an empty market ... phone commonwealth bank australiaWeb31 de out. de 2024 · The local Shapley values sum to the model output, and global Shapley values sum to the overall model accuracy, so that they can be intuitively … phone companies hiring near meWebof model predictions: Shapley regression values [4], Shapley sampling values [9], and Quantitative Input Influence [3]. Shapley regression values are feature importances for linear models in the presence of multicollinearity. This method requires retraining the model on all feature subsets S F, where Fis the set of all features. how do you make an onlyfans accountWeb16 de dez. de 2024 · SHAP (and Shapley) values are approximations of the model's behaviour. They are not guarantee to account perfectly on how a model works. ... If I include a footnote stating that the estimated percent contributions are calculated after removing the common denominator of the mean prediction, ... how do you make an old fashioned drink